== DNA Pre-load Submissions == :Describes samples that upon submission to the BMC can be immediately plugged into the preparatory method that has been specified in the project submission form. This option is provided to reduce library preparation costs and expedite sample processing by minimizing hands-on time by a BMC staff. The specific requirements are listed for each preparatory method (excluding 16S) in the tables above. These specifications must be met in order to qualify as a pre-load, submissions otherwise may be subject to additional charges.<br> :Due to the nature of a pre-load submission, the entire volume of sample submitted will be used and as such, additional services are not typically offered unless coordinated with a BMC technician. It is important to keep this in mind when submitting precious samples and the BMC recommends to save a portion of sample when possibly. <br>
